A member asked:

How accurate is ultrasound at 16 weeks pregnancy for gender detection if baby cooperate. is it 80% or 85% or 95%. based on experience and medical papers?

Depends on fetus: 16 weeks is quite early, and there is never a guarantee. If the fetus spreads it's legs and is in the right position for the us technologist, it can be very easy to tell the gender. If the fetus does not cooperate, then the accuracy goes down, to just guessing or flipping a coin (50%). It is easier to tell at 20 weeks or so (everything is bigger). Ask the tech how confident they are.
